JR East's AI Powers Shinkansen Precision
JR East analyzes sensor data with machine learning models. AI predicts track faults hours in advance. Maintenance teams resolve issues before delays occur.
This approach cuts downtime by 30% on 320 km/h lines (JR East, 2024). Nigeria Railway Corporation (NRC) reports 25% annual breakdown rates (NRC Annual Report, 2023).

Cybersecurity Fortifies Japan's AI Rail Networks
IoT sensors generate terabytes of data daily, attracting hackers. JR East enforces end-to-end encryption and quarterly penetration tests (JR East development tech, 2024).
Firewalls isolate control systems. Zero-trust models verify all access requests.
Nigeria's Data Protection Act 2023 demands equivalent measures. NITDA requires secure-by-design principles for AI rails (NITDA, Oct 2024). CcHUB trains founders on these defenses.
